ArizonaWildcats.com sat down with sophomore Sam Manley from San Diego, California to learn more about her focus and some of her beach volleyball history.
Q: How has your transition been from freshman to sophomore year?
A: Confidence is a big factor when transitioning from freshman to sophomore year. Freshman year, serves are coming at a quicker pace, everyone around you is older, and you've never experienced games at a college level. Having that experience gives you confidence, and I think confidence is a really big factor in this game and in your performance.
Q: Now that you have a couple of games under your belt, what are some personal improvements that you would like to make?
A: I want to clean up my passing a little bit more and work on expanding my offense. Mixing up my shots more and not letting the defender get comfortable or let them feel confident that I am going to hit the ball in a certain area is what I would like to improve on.

Q: What is it like playing with Hailey Devlin since you have known her for so long?
A: It feels really natural playing with Hailey (Devlin). We've been playing for 4 to 5 years now. Our chemistry is really strong, and even if we can't get the words out of our mouths, the other person knows what we want. Our strengths play on each other's, so we mesh really well together.
Q: What is your earliest beach volleyball memory?
A: When I was little, I used to play with my sister, and I just remember being really frustrated at myself. I also remember my family being all together at the beach and us just messing around because I wasn't an intense player yet.
Q: Do you have any pre game rituals?
A: I usually stick to myself for a longer period of time before the game. I play better what I'm calm. Sometimes I even do homework, keep to myself, listen to some music, and right before, our team gets hype together. We listen to music and dance.
